Starfleet Command: Orion Pirates is a stand-alone expansion for the computer game Star Trek Starfleet Command II: Empires at War. The game adds eight separate playable pirate cartels based on the Orion Pirates, who had been frequently fought throughout the earlier games. It also oppened up a multiplayer Dynaverse for on-line play. Players may also play via the GameSpy Service.

Galactic Governments:

In addition to these 8 which were in the original Starfleet Command II: Empires at War there are 8 Pirate cartels.

  • The Orion Cartel
  • The Camboro Cartel
  • The Crimson Shadow (The House of Korgath)
  • Prime Industries
  • The Tiger Heart Cartel
  • The Beast Raiders
  • The Syndicate
  • The Wyldefire Compact
